Crushed stone comes in many sizes, from fine screenings to large rip rap. The right size depends on your project. Here are the sizes available from Gravel Monkey in Alamogordo.
| Product | Best Use |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| 3/8" Crushed Stone | Paver setting bed and tight fill | Ideal for paver setting beds and tight fill applications where a compact, uniform stone is needed. |
| 3/4" Crushed Stone | The all-purpose size for base and drainage | The go-to size for base layers, drainage, and general construction projects. |
| 1"-1 1/2" Crushed Stone | Heavy base and erosion control | Ideal for heavy base work and erosion control where larger, angular stone is required. |
| 2"-3" Crushed Stone | Rip rap style edging and deep fill | Used as rip rap for edging and deep fill in areas with water flow or slope stabilization. |
| #57 Crushed Stone | Concrete aggregate, French drains, driveway base | A popular choice for concrete aggregate, French drains, and driveway base applications. |
| #67 Stone | Concrete mix and drainage backfill | Suitable for concrete mix and drainage backfill behind retaining walls. |
| #8 Stone | Paver joints and pipe bedding | Used for paver joints and pipe bedding to provide a stable, compacted base. |
| #10 Rock Screenings | Leveling course under pavers | A fine material used as a leveling course under pavers for a smooth surface. |
Each project type has a crushed stone size that works best. Use this table to match your project to the recommended product.
| Project | What to Order | Depth or Note |
|---|---|---|
| Concrete slab base | 3/4" Crushed Stone | 4 to 6 inches for a stable base |
| Paver bedding | 3/8" Crushed Stone | 1 to 2 inches as setting bed |
| Pipe backfill | #67 Stone | 2 to 3 inches around pipe |
| French drain | #57 Crushed Stone | 6 to 12 inches depth |
| Driveway base layer | 3/4" Crushed Stone | 4 to 8 inches depth |

The area sees about 106 freezing days per year, but the ground rarely freezes deep enough to cause frost heave. Without a hard freeze to lift the surface, drainage and washout are what decide how long the material lasts. Your crushed stone base does not need extra depth for frost protection.
The soil around Alamogordo takes water in slowly and sheds a fair amount across the surface. For a crushed stone project, that means you should plan for surface water. A deeper drainage layer helps prevent washout and keeps the stone stable over time.
To estimate tonnage, measure the length and width of your area in feet and multiply for square footage. Multiply by the desired depth in inches and divide by about 200 (the cubic feet per ton for most crushed stone). For vehicle loads like driveways, a crushed stone base of 4 to 6 inches is typical. Deeper layers may be needed for heavier traffic or softer soil conditions.
The 3/4-inch crushed stone is the most common all-purpose size. It is used for base layers, drainage, and general construction.
